Bentley Shooting Brake W12

The days of Rolls-Royce derivatives are over

By Todd Lassa

Text Size

Hot on the heels of Bentley's shapely new Continental GT ("First Look," September 2002), Volkswagen AG's new luxury marque is looking at more variants. Though a long-wheelbase sedan version will be first up, a more intriguing spinoff may be the Shooting Brake (the British nickname for a sport wagon).

If given the green light, expect the GT's 500-plus-hp twin-turbocharged 6.0L W-12 to propel all four wheels. The transmission would be a paddle-operated six-speed automatic. The GT's suspension is a multilink rear with a double-wishbone front and electronic damping, so expect that in the Shooting Brake, as well.
